Ancient and Medieval Manuscript Leaves collection

 Collection — Box: Communal Collections 55
Identifier: MSP 136
Abstract

The Ancient and Medieval Manuscript Leaves collection contains leaves from Breviaries, Books of Hours, Antiphonaries, Bibles, an Anthology of Persian Poetry, Byzantine Music Notation, and a papyrus fragment.  The collection demonstrates a variety of medieval texts and artistic styles.  This particular collection is an excellent teaching tool for many classes in the humanities.

Dates: 30 B.C.E. - 18th Century

Sandor "Alex" Kvassay papers and collection of Aviation Stamps

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SP 144
Scope and Contents The Sandor "Alex" Kvassay papers and collection of Aviation Stamps document the history of aviation and flight through postage stamps, postmarks and envelopes collected from all over the world. The collection spans the 20th century and the beginning of the 21st century but includes examples of 19th century balloon airmail. The stamps are housed in 67 albums and total near 68,000 stamps, envelopes, postmarks and postcards. The collection was assembled over a period of 20 years,...
Dates: 1870 - 2014; Other: Majority of material found within 1920 - 1990
